    Artwork Submission

    Before submitting artwork to Kornit X, the LGM Merchandising Team must verify that the artwork file accurately matches the approved product mock-up.

    Artwork should be submitted via a Dropbox URL.

    Best Practice:
    A single parent Dropbox folder containing all relevant artwork and supporting files is preferred over individual Dropbox links for each product.

    To avoid delays, artwork should be supplied in accordance with any agreed project timelines and launch deadlines.

    Branding

    Existing Branding

    For questions relating to existing branding options, please contact the Kornit X Strategic Account Team.

    New Branding Requests

    For new branding requirements, please contact the Kornit X Strategic Account Team.

    Please note the following lead times for branding setup:
    1. New Branding Group: Up to 30 days
    2. New option within an existing Branding Group (e.g., a new hang tag): Up to 7 days


    Samples

    Sample Approval Options

    The appropriate approval method should be determined based on partner requirements and communicated to the Kornit X Onboarding Team.  
    The following sample approval methods are available:
    1. Physical Sample A physical product sample is shipped to the Merchandising Team for review and approval.
    1. Photo Approval Photographs of the physical sample are provided for review and approval.
    1. Digital Mock-Up A digital representation of the product is shared via URL. This option is typically used when a physical sample is not required.
    1. No Sample RequiredNo sample approval is required.

    Sample Rejection Process

    If a sample is rejected due to artwork-related issues, LGM Merch Team should:
    1. Clearly document the required changes.
    2. Communicate the amendments to the LGM Art Team.
    3. Resubmit the updated artwork to Kornit X.
    4. Where required, a revised sample will be produced for further review.
